Discover the Aviation Cocktail: A Timeless Classic

If you're looking for a cocktail that embodies elegance and sophistication, look no further than the Aviation cocktail. This vibrant purple drink is a delightful blend of gin, crème de violette, maraschino liqueur, and freshly squeezed lemon juice. With its enchanting color and unique flavor profile, the Aviation cocktail is a perfect choice for special occasions or simply indulging in a bit of luxury at home.

Ingredients for the Aviation Cocktail

To create this exquisite cocktail, you will need the following ingredients:

Read more

Essential Ingredients

  • Gin: Opt for a high-quality gin, as its flavor plays a crucial role in the overall taste of the cocktail. A popular choice is Hendrick’s gin, known for its floral notes.

  • Maraschino Liqueur: Look for a premium maraschino liqueur, such as Luxardo, which adds a sweet and slightly nutty flavor to the mix.

  • Crème De Violette: This floral liqueur is the star ingredient that provides the Aviation cocktail with its signature violet hue. Its delicate flavor enhances the drink's complexity.

  • Lemon Juice: Freshly squeezed lemon juice is essential for balancing the sweetness of the liqueurs, adding a refreshing citrus note.

Step-by-Step Instructions to Craft the Aviation Cocktail

Creating the Aviation cocktail is a straightforward and enjoyable process. Follow these steps to make your own at home:

Read more

Preparation

  1. Chill the Glass: Start by chilling your coupe glass. Place the glass in the freezer for 30 minutes to an hour before serving. While this step is optional, it enhances the drinking experience by keeping your cocktail cold.
Read more

Mixing the Cocktail

  1. Combine Ingredients: In a cocktail shaker filled with ice, add the following ingredients:

    • 2 ounces of gin
    • 1/2 ounce of maraschino liqueur
    • 1/2 ounce of crème de violette
    • 3/4 ounce of freshly squeezed lemon juice
  2. Shake: Secure the lid on the shaker and shake vigorously for about 10-15 seconds. The goal is to chill the mixture thoroughly and combine the flavors.

  3. Strain: Using a fine mesh strainer, pour the mixture into the chilled coupe glass. This will ensure a smooth and refined presentation.
Read more

Garnishing

  1. Add a Garnish: Finish your Aviation cocktail by adding a maraschino cherry or a twist of lemon peel. If you choose the lemon twist, give it a gentle squeeze over the drink to release its essential oils before dropping it in.

Understanding Crème De Violette

What is Crème De Violette?

Read more

Crème de violette is a unique floral liqueur made from violet petals. The process involves soaking the petals in a neutral spirit, such as brandy, for several days. This extraction method captures the delicate floral notes and vibrant color, creating a liqueur that is both sweet and aromatic. The flavor profile of crème de violette is reminiscent of violet candies, making it a delightful addition to various cocktails.

A Brief History of the Aviation Cocktail

The Aviation cocktail has a rich history that dates back to the early 20th century. It was first documented in 1916 in a cocktail recipe book by Hugo Ensslin, who was the head bartender at Hotel Wallick in New York City. The drink's name is often associated with the early days of aviation, capturing the romanticism of flight during a time when air travel was a luxury reserved for the wealthy.

Read more

The Cocktail's Rise and Fall

During the 1960s, crème de violette became increasingly difficult to find, leading to a decline in the popularity of the Aviation cocktail. In the 1930s, renowned bartender Harry Craddock included a version of the drink in his famous "The Savoy Cocktail Book," but this variation lacked the signature violet liqueur.

Read more

For more than four decades, the Aviation cocktail faded into obscurity, with few cocktail enthusiasts aware of its existence. However, the cocktail revival that began in the early 2000s brought it back into the spotlight.

Read more

The Resurgence

In 2007, a company called Haus Alpenz began importing Rothman & Winter crème de violette from Austria, coinciding perfectly with the resurgence of classic cocktails. This revival allowed bartenders and home mixologists alike to rediscover the Aviation cocktail, leading to its reappearance on cocktail menus across the United States and beyond.

Read more

Today, other brands, such as The Bitter Truth and Giffard, offer their own versions of violet liqueurs, making it easier than ever to create this stunning cocktail at home.

Tips for Crafting the Perfect Aviation Cocktail

Pro Tips for Success

Read more
  1. Chill Your Glass: As mentioned earlier, chilling your glass can elevate the overall drinking experience. A cold glass helps keep the cocktail refreshingly cool.

  2. Fresh Lemon Juice: Always use freshly squeezed lemon juice for the best flavor. Bottled lemon juice lacks the brightness and acidity needed for this cocktail.

  3. Quality Matters: The flavor of the gin is prominent in the Aviation cocktail, so use a high-quality brand that you enjoy. Experimenting with different gins can yield interesting variations.

  4. Sweetness Levels: If you prefer a sweeter cocktail, consider adding a touch of simple syrup (about 1/8 ounce) to balance the tartness of the lemon juice.

Variations of the Aviation Cocktail

For those looking to experiment, there are several variations on the classic Aviation cocktail that you can try:

Read more

Violette Royale

Add a splash of champagne or sparkling wine to your Aviation cocktail for a delightful Violette Royale. The bubbles add an effervescent touch to the floral flavors, making it perfect for celebrations.

Read more

Without Crème De Violette

If you can't find crème de violette, you can still enjoy a version of the Aviation cocktail without it. While it won't have the signature purple hue, it will still be delicious and refreshing.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why is it called the Aviation cocktail?

Read more

The name "Aviation" evokes imagery of the sky, reminiscent of the pale purple and blue colors often seen in the atmosphere. The cocktail's name pays homage to the early days of aviation, when flying was a thrilling and luxurious experience.

Read more

What are the key ingredients in an Aviation cocktail?

The primary ingredients in an Aviation cocktail include gin, maraschino liqueur, crème de violette, and freshly squeezed lemon juice. Each component contributes to the drink's unique flavor and eye-catching color.

Read more

Can I make the Aviation cocktail in advance?

While it's best to prepare the Aviation cocktail fresh to maintain its vibrant flavors and stunning appearance, you can pre-measure the ingredients and mix them in advance. When you're ready to serve, simply shake with ice and strain into a chilled glass.
